Ilkeston news. The town appears as Tilchestune in the Domesday Book of 1086, when it was owned principally by Gilbert de Ghent. Almost equidistant between the cities of Derby (ten miles) and Nottingham (eight miles) it is well connected via the M1 motorway. The town has a rich history, dating back to the Roman times, and has been an important industrial center for centuries. Formerly a coal-mining town, it has managed to remain a thriving industrial centre. Ilkeston is one of several places where the distinctive dialect of East Midlands English is extensively spoken.
